Question: Avoid hyperextending an infant's neck because it can:
Answer options:
- Open the airway better ✅ Obstruct the airway
- Cause hypothermia
- Increase pulse
Correct answer: Obstruct the airway
Explanation: Hyperextension may collapse the soft airway. The correct answer is "Obstruct the airway". This reflects the accepted standard for the firstaid assessment and aligns with the official handbook for this competency.
